To date, KVM has allowed guests to use paravirtual interfaces regardless
of the configured CPUID. While almost any guest will consult the
KVM_CPUID_FEATURES leaf _before_ using PV features, it is still
undesirable to have such interfaces silently present.

This series aims to address the issue by adding explicit checks against
the guest's CPUID when servicing any paravirtual feature. Since this
effectively changes the guest/hypervisor ABI, a KVM_CAP is warranted to
guard the new behavior.

Patches 1-2 refactor some of the PV code in anticipation of the change.
Patch 3 introduces the checks + KVM_CAP. Finally, patch 4 fixes some doc
typos that were noticed when working on this series.
